WHAT DOES CHEW OVER M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Definition of chew over in the English dictionary

The definition of chew over in the dictionary is to consider carefully; ruminate on.

The American Heritage Dictionary of Idioms, Second Edition
2. chew the cud Also, chew over. Ponder over, meditate, as in John tends to chew the cud before he answers, or Let me chew that over and let you know. The first term, first recorded in 1382, transfers the appearance of a patiently ruminating ...
Christine Ammer, 2013
